Output 3b313dec56e56ffa6b65efea46f601f752d44eecb9d97eeae38b4a7258d4ea03:0

value
439584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5afe93fb2387eb65241fea8845875bdfc771bc OP_EQUAL
address
3MsSGLrk7m1h2yWKXLJ2G3w4kCftYEgzhu
transaction
3b313dec56e56ffa6b65efea46f601f752d44eecb9d97eeae38b4a7258d4ea03
confirmations
435000
spent
true